Originally Posted by FlyinHawaiian
Exit the gate are in Terminal A and follow the signs to Concourses C and D. There's a waiting area there where the mobile lounges dock (think of the lounge as a large bus).

There will either be a lounge docked at the terminal (the entrance doors will be open) or the doors will be closed and there will be a countdown clock indicating when the next one will depart. In that case, you hang out in the waiting area until a lounge docks.

Wait for the lounge to Concourse C. While C and D are both part of one long concourse, in general, you are not going to save any time catching a D lounge for a C departure gate.

The lounge will drive you from A to C, it's a neat drive as you have to cross the tarmac and will see many planes at the gates and moving on the tarmac.
I don't believe there are D gate mobile lounges from the A Gates, only over to C gates and to the main terminal. If you have a D gate, just take the C gate mobile lounge and walk to the D gates, that's the quickest way.
